Q: Is 959,361 a Composite Number?

 A: Yes, 959,361 is a composite number.

Why is 959,361 a composite number?

A composite number is a number that can be divided evenly by more numbers than 1 and itself. It is the opposite of a prime number.

The number 959,361 can be evenly divided by 1 3 13 17 39 51 221 663 1,447 4,341 18,811 24,599 56,433 73,797 319,787 and 959,361, with no remainder.

Since 959,361 cannot be divided by just 1 and 959,361, it is a composite number.
